High-quality graded materials which support literacy development
Story Books
- Well designed, attractive, durable, appropriate size
- Graded; language already part of oral repertoire
- Repetition and recycling of vocabulary and sentence structures
- Illustrations: Support meaning; construct positive identities; learners envisage themselves as readers and writers
- Cover range of topics (fiction and non-fiction); deal with important concepts; creative
- Supplemented with songs/rhymes and exercises to consolidate and extend what has been learnt
Big Books
- Sturdy, printed back- to- back
- Excellent resource for shared, side-by-side reading in which teacher provides model of ‘a reader’ and apprentices child into reading
Workbook
- Exercises are varied and well-conceptualised
- Includes: handwriting exercises; various exercises working with letters and words; choosing words to label pictures; completing sentences; writing a sentence using a simple frame; writing a paragraph using a model
- Consistent format of activities/lessons helps teacher and learners
Teacher’s Guide
- Well-designed; correct length; very practical
- Methodologically sound; clear explanation of lessons
- Supports teachers’ interaction with learners, e.g., provides excellent questions for shared reading
- Provides the structure for units
- Excellent section on homework (simple, sound and feasible) and includes worksheets that can be photocopied
- Excellent section on assessment
- Begins to develop meta-language for understanding and talking about literacy in Xhosa; recognises that teachers are bilinguals
